MEMORANDUM OPINION


Robert L. Edwards II appealed an order denying relief in a suit affecting the parent-child relationship. The appeal was submitted without briefs because the appellant failed to file his brief by the March 11, 2006 due date. See Tex.R.App.P. 38.6(a). The appellant did not request additional time to file the brief. See Tex.R.App.P. 38.6(d). On May 1, 2006, we notified the parties that the appeal would be advanced without oral argument. See Tex.R.App.P. 39.9. In the absence of a brief assigning error, we dismiss the appeal for want of prosecution. Tex.R.App.P. 38.8(a)(1).
